      Why does the airbag light stay on?

      Light stays on and warning for airbag service on reader board. If the airbag light stays on after it completes it’s “check light” process then there is a fault in the air bag system. It could be anything from a bad sensor (there are 3 of them) to a wire that has become unplugged. This problem should be repaired as soon as possible because…

      How are airbags fixed after an accident?

      After an accident occurs, airbags are fixed by resetting the sensors and replacing the airbag unit. Most modern vehicles will not allow you to reset an airbag for safety precautions, and instead, you must replace it entirely. This requires removing the old airbag from the driver or passenger side and installing a new one.

      Is it safe to drive with air bag light on?

      Driving with the airbag light on isn’t very likely to cause damage to your vehicle, but your airbags will not deploy in the event of an accident, which makes your car much less safe. When you see the airbag light illuminate, find a safe place to park the car and book a mechanic to perform a thorough diagnosis.

      Why does my airbag light flash on and off?

      After continued use, the thin circuit bands that make up your airbag clock spring may become brittle or worn out. This leads to a sporadic connection of your driver’s airbag. If this is the case, the system will send a code to your computer and the airbag light will turn on or flash.
